How much does a Registered Nurse make in Richfield, OH?

The average salary for a Registered Nurse is $76,417 per year in Richfield, OH.

Registered Nurses (RNs) in Richfield, OH, enjoy a rewarding career with a competitive salary. On average, an RN earns about $76,417 per year. This figure reflects the dedication and hard work that nurses put into their jobs. The salary can vary based on experience, education, and specific healthcare facilities.

Many factors can influence the exact salary an RN earns. For instance, those with more years of experience or specialized skills tend to make more. Also, certain employers, like hospitals or outpatient care centers, may offer higher wages. These variations show that as RNs grow in their careers, their earnings can increase. What are the highest paying cities for a Registered Nurse near Richfield, OH?

Registered Nurses near Richfield, OH, can find high paying jobs in several nearby cities. Mayfield Heights offers the highest average salary at $112,439. Cleveland follows closely with an average salary of $96,612. These areas provide strong opportunities for professionals seeking better compensation. Other cities like Garfield Heights and Independence also offer attractive average salaries, making them viable options. Akron and Strongsville also present good earning potential, though slightly less than the top two cities. Job seekers should explore these areas for a balance of salary and job availability.
